The decision to DIY or hire a professional PPF installation service primarily hinges on your comfort level working with hands-on projects and your priorities for your vehicle’s protection. While DIY installations can save money and provide a sense of accomplishment, they can also result in costly mistakes that require extensive repainting or additional professional intervention. Professional installers prioritize skilled craftsmanship, premium materials, and comprehensive customer service to deliver top-tier results for a long-term protective effect.
When comparing installers, look for certification and years of experience. These metrics indicate a solid track record of success and a deep understanding of the complexities of handling PPF Installers applications. Professional installation services typically offer a warranty on their work, which provides peace of mind in the event of any errors or issues with the application. These warranties can cover any necessary rework or replacement of the film for up to a certain amount of time, providing added security for your investment.
One of the most significant benefits of a professional PPF installation is that it can significantly reduce the likelihood of imperfections, such as air bubbles or misalignment, which are commonly associated with DIY installations. This is because professional installers are trained to handle the intricacies of the application process and ensure a smooth, seamless finish that safeguards your vehicle against damage caused by everyday use.
Another benefit of professional installers is that they often have access to high-quality films, which are designed to withstand the harsh elements of nature. These films are durable and protect the paint of your vehicle against scratches, scrapes, road debris, and UV rays. They can also retain their clarity over time, ensuring that your paint looks as good as new even after prolonged exposure to sunlight.
When comparing installers, find out whether they offer a variety of PPF products to meet different needs and preferences. For example, some providers may offer precut kits for specific vehicle models to simplify the application process. Others may feature a wide range of tints that enhance the aesthetics of your car.
